Kinds Of Eco-Friendly Copy Paper
Environment-friendly copy paper is available in numerous types, customized to various requirements and applications. Here's a breakdown of the most common types:
1. Recycled Paper
Made from utilized paper products, this type is available in differing percentages of recycled content. The greater the portion, the more environmentally friendly it generally is.
2. Sustainable Paper
Sourced from trees that are grown in sustainably handled forests, these papers typically bear certifications such as the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) label.
3. Tree-Free Paper
Produced from alternative fibers such as hemp, bamboo, and kenaf, tree-free documents use a sustainable option that bypasses traditional forestry totally.
4. Green Seal Certified Paper
This paper meets strict standards set by the Green Seal organization, which evaluates items based upon their ecological impact.
5. Chlorine-Free Paper
This paper is produced without the hazardous whitening representatives that contribute to environmental pollution and can be an exceptional option for businesses worried about their chemical footprint.

Navigating the numerous alternatives offered can be intimidating. Here are some factors to consider when choosing environmentally friendly copy paper:
Check for Certifications: Look for trusted certifications such as FSC, Green Seal, or Cradle to Cradle. These labels assure consumers of the item's environmental integrity.
Think About Recycled Content: Higher recycled content typically means a lower ecological effect. Goal for documents with a minimum of 30% recycled material for regular use.
Understand Your Printing Needs: Evaluate the type of printing (inkjet, laser, and so on) and ensure compatibility with the paper's requirements.
Analyze Packaging: Even the product packaging of the paper can have an ecological impact. Pick items with minimal, recyclable, or naturally degradable packaging.
Evaluate Price vs. Quality: While environmentally friendly choices might be slightly more expensive, the long-lasting benefits can exceed the preliminary expenses. Factor in quality and performance together with price.
